England's final World Cup warm-up ends with a win, and perhaps most importantly: no injuries.

Ali Maxwell and George Elek react to England's 1-0 victory over New Zealand in Florida, where Harry Kane's 79th England goal settled a game that saw Thomas Tuchel give minutes to two entirely different XIs across the two halves.

They discuss the performances of Marcus Rashford, Djed Spence and Elliot Anderson, and a hugely encouraging senior debut for 17-year-old Rio Ngumoha.

Plenty of questions still remain - but this game will have little impact on what happens in 10 days time, so let's not take it too seriously eh? Anyone for a hard tea?
